Here we go again! This week I think I've found the exact amount of water to pour that is 4.5L per pot. Starting from 3L I increased half a liter every watering session, the runoff on the saucer has always been absorbed within some hours until i poured 5L, in this case even 6 hours after watering the runoff hasn't been absorbed by the soil so i just removed it from the saucer and found my optimal amount. Beside this, summer is going on and the temperatures are raising, now I have 26/27°C night/day but the plants don't seem to suffer for that, they still seems pretty healthy at my newbie eyes :) Next week I'll provide some pictures with natural light, so you can see their true colors. Since this is my first time with topping and LST, it would be nice to have some feedback/comment from other growers. I'm wondering when i can switch to 12/12: I'd like to do this ASAP since the temperatures will raise a lot in summer (i expect 30°C in the end of june)

Barney’s Amnesia Lemon , will response well to topping and HST , so LST won’t be a problem. You will need around 8 to 9 weeks to harvest... so it’s probably time to switch now or ASAP like you said to avoid the summer heat !
